2020成考期末C语言考试题
摘要:1.(1分)以下程序段运行后,循环体运行的次数为()。inti=8,a=0;for(;i<8;i++)a+=i;A.0次2.(1分)若有定义语句:intb=0x17;printf(“%d”,b++);,其正确的输出结果是()。A.233.(1分)以下正确的实型常量是()。B..5798994.(1分)执行下面程序中的输出语句后,输出结果是(#includevoidmain(){inta;printf("%d\n",(a=3*5,a*4,a+5));}B:205.)。(1分)给出以下定义:charx[]=“abcdefg”;chary[]={'a','b','c','d','e','f','g'};则正确的叙述为()。C.数组x的长度大于数组y的长度6.(1分)下列初始化语句中,正确且与语句charc[]="string";等价的是()。D.charc[7]={'s','t','r','i','n','g','\0'}7.(1分)设已定义:chars1[8],s2[8]="Science";能将字符串"Science"赋给数组s1的语句是()。C.strcpy(s1,s2)8.(1分)若在C语言中未说明函数的类型,则系统默认该函数的数据类型是()。C.Int9.(1分)若已定义inta=5;int*p=&a;则正确的解释是(D.是在对p定义的同时进行初始化,使p指向a10.(1分))。while循环,当执行以下程序段时()。<br/>x=-1;<br/>do<br/>{x=x*x;}<br/>while(!x);A.循环体将执行一次11.(1分)
温馨提示:当前文档最多只能预览
5 页,若文档总页数超出了
5 页,请下载原文档以浏览全部内容。
本文档由 匿名用户 于 2020-07-02 12:30:20上传分享